Subject: Handover — Fernwiki access roles

Hi Dario,

Handing over release duties for the Fernwiki platform before I'm out next week. Quick summary for your review: role-based access is now enforced at the namespace level, so editors on the Brindlehop space can't touch the Ops runbooks anymore. Admin grants go through the Tollgate approval queue — nothing manual, please. One thing you'll need right away: deploys to the wiki cluster must be signed, and the rotation happened Tuesday. The current signing key is below.

rollout seal: bky4_DFM9

Subject: DR drill — tax cache

All,

Wednesday 0900 we simulate total loss of the Bramhollow tax-rate lookup cache. You will rebuild it from the Ostreth source-of-truth feed and verify rates for ten sample jurisdictions. Target: warm cache in under 40 minutes. New hires participate; no observers. Read the runbook beforehand. Access to the rebuild console requires the recovery passphrase given below.

vault phrase of tajeg-tageg = pelix-druix-holius-briael-zorwyn-frawyn-fraox-norok-drueth-aldiel

Minutes — Management Meeting, Harlick & Voss Trading

Attendees: regional leads plus Dara Quellen chairing. Main topic: the revised commission scheme. Short version: base rates drop a notch, but the kicker for multi-year contracts nearly doubles, which most branches should welcome. Tomas flagged that the Westmere branch needs a transition buffer; agreed, one quarter. Payout timing moves to monthly. Full tables go out Friday — please don't circulate beyond your teams. One more thing before we wrapped: Dara shared the confidential outlook below.

board note of fadug-yafog: Only 39 of the 474 pilot accounts renewed Belion, so a churn review is set for September 6. Wenixax Logistics is in early talks to buy Gorirek Systems for about $270.9 million.

## Handover: Brickforge Component Library Versioning

Brickforge moves to strict semver next sprint. Breaking changes require a major bump plus a migration note; the release script enforces this via changelog tags. Security-relevant patches must be backported to the last two majors. All published versions are signed at build time. The signing key custodian and release owner is named below.

named custodian: Oliath Ralax